The Praher Blue Ball Valve 2.5" (250-ES00) delivers the precision control and durability pool contractors demand for professional installations. This NSF 61 certified PVC valve features Praher's innovative single union design that prevents union nut load transfer to the ball seat, ensuring smooth operation and extended service life for commercial pool systems.

Professional Installation Benefits

Designed for contractor efficiency, this compact ball valve reduces installation time with its user-friendly slip socket ports and SCH 40 design. The 150 PSI pressure rating and superior corrosion resistance make it ideal for demanding pool applications, while the BUNA-N O-rings and HDPE seals provide reliable, leak-free performance that protects your reputation.

Frequently Asked Questions

What makes the Praher single union design superior?

Praher's unique single union design prevents union nut load from transferring to the ball seat, providing smoother operation and longer valve life compared to standard ball valves.

Is this valve NSF certified for pool applications?

Yes, the 250-ES00 is constructed from NSF 61 certified PVC material, meeting safety standards for potable water and pool applications.

What pressure rating can this valve handle?

The Praher 250-ES00 is rated for 150 PSI working pressure and 29.9" Mercury vacuum rating, suitable for most commercial pool system requirements.
